Engelsaugen
(German Cookies)
Delicious German thumbprint cookies with tender jam-filled centres!

Step 1:
HOW TO MAKE
- whisk butter and sugar in a bowl until creamy. - add the egg yolks, vanilla sugar, and grated rind (peel) of lemon and combine.

Step 2:
WEEATATLAST.COM
-add the salt, - then gradually add the flour, while combining. - mix until you get a homogenous dough.

Step 3:
HOW TO MAKE
- cover the dough and allow it to chill in the fridge for at least 30 minutes.

Step 4:
HOW TO MAKE
- once chilled, roll the dough between the palms of your hands to form small balls.

Step 5:
-place the rolled dough balls on lined baking trays and make indentations in the middle. - bake the cookies until done.

Step 5:
- once done, use a small spoon to fill the centers with jam or marmalade. - sprinkle some powdered sugar on top.
